Application of Frequency Attribute Analysis to Identification of Conglomerate Body—An example of Wu-27 Wellblock in Wu-Xia faultbelt

Abstract: There exists a set of thick conglomerate body in Xiazijie formation of Permian in Wuerhe area in Wu-Xia fault belt, and highyield oil zone was found at the top of it. However, it is not obvious differences in seismic reflection between the conglomerate and underlying strata, which allow the identification and tracing to be difficult. This paper presents in-depth research on that by frequency attribute analysis and finds out the reflected differences. By 3D seismic data process, the conglomerate feature is confirmed, and its plane distribution is outlined. The results show a coincidence with the well data.

Key words: frequency attribute, conglomerate, time-frequency analysis, frequency division section
